    • Update GCC to autoconf 2.69, automake 1.15.1 (PR bootstrap/82856). · 22e05272
      This patch updates GCC to use autoconf 2.69 and automake 1.15.1.
      (That's not the latest automake version, but it's the one used by
      binutils-gdb, with which consistency is desirable, and in any case
      seems a useful incremental update that should make a future update to
      1.16.1 easier.)
      
      The changes are generally similar to the binutils-gdb ones, and are
      copied from there where shared files and directories are involved
      (there are some further changes to such shared directories, however,
      which I'd expect to apply to binutils-gdb once this patch is in GCC).
      Largely, obsolete AC_PREREQ calls are removed, while many
      AC_LANG_SOURCE calls are added to avoid warnings from aclocal and
      autoconf.  Multilib support is no longer included in core automake,
      meaning that multilib.am needs copying from automake's contrib
      directory into the GCC source tree.  Autoconf 2.69 has Go support, so
      local copies of that support are removed.  I hope the D support will
      soon be submitted to upstream autoconf so the local copy of that can
      be removed in a future update.  Changes to how automake generates
      runtest calls mean quotes are removed from RUNTEST definitions in five
      lib*/testsuite/Makefile.am files (libatomic, libgomp, libitm,
      libphobos, libvtv; some others have RUNTEST definitions without
      quotes, which are still OK); libgo and libphobos also get
      -Wno-override added to AM_INIT_AUTOMAKE so those overrides of RUNTEST
      do not generate automake warnings.
      
      Note that the regeneration did not include regeneration of
      fixincludes/config.h.in (attempting such regeneration resulted in all
      the USED_FOR_TARGET conditionals disappearing; and I don't see
      anything in the fixincludes/ directory that would result in such
      conditionals being generated, unlike in the gcc/ directory).  Also
      note that libvtv/testsuite/other-tests/Makefile.in was not
      regenerated; that directory is not listed as a subdirectory for which
      Makefile.in gets regenerated by calling "automake" in libvtv/, so I'm
      not sure how it's meant to be regenerated.
      
      While I mostly fixed warnings should running aclocal / automake /
      autoconf, there were various such warnings from automake in the
      libgfortran, libgo, libgomp, liboffloadmic, libsanitizer, libphobos
      directories that I did not fix, preferring to leave those to the
      relevant subsystem maintainers.  Specifically, most of those warnings
      were of the following form (example from libgfortran):
      
      Makefile.am:48: warning: source file 'caf/single.c' is in a subdirectory,
      Makefile.am:48: but option 'subdir-objects' is disabled
      automake: warning: possible forward-incompatibility.
      automake: At least a source file is in a subdirectory, but the 'subdir-objects'
      automake: automake option hasn't been enabled.  For now, the corresponding output
      automake: object file(s) will be placed in the top-level directory.  However,
      automake: this behaviour will change in future Automake versions: they
      will
      automake: unconditionally cause object files to be placed in the same subdirectory
      automake: of the corresponding sources.
      automake: You are advised to start using 'subdir-objects' option throughout your
      automake: project, to avoid future incompatibilities.
      
      I think it's best for the relevant maintainers to add subdir-objects
      and do any other associated Makefile.am changes needed.  In some cases
      the paths in the warnings involved ../; I don't know if that adds any
      extra complications to the use of subdir-objects.
      
      I've tested this with native, cross and Canadian cross builds.  The
      risk of any OS-specific issues should I hope be rather lower than if a
      libtool upgrade were included (we *should* do such an upgrade at some
      point, but it's more complicated - it involves identifying all our
      local libtool changes to see if any aren't included in the upstream
      version we update to, and reverting an upstream libtool patch that's
      inappropriate for use in GCC); I think it would be better to get this
      update into GCC so that people can test in different configurations
      and we can fix any issues found, rather than to try to get more and
      more testing done before it goes in.

    • [nvptx] Ignore c++ exceptions · 77e0a97a
      The nvptx port can't support exceptions using sjlj, because ptx does not
      support sjlj.  However, default_except_unwind_info still returns UI_SJLJ, even
      even if we configure with --disable-sjlj-exceptions, because UI_SJLJ is the
      fallback option.
      
      The reason default_except_unwind_info doesn't return UI_DWARF2 is because
      DWARF2_UNWIND_INFO is not defined in defaults.h, because
      INCOMING_RETURN_ADDR_RTX is not defined, because there's no ptx equivalent.
      
      Testcase libgomp.c++/for-15.C currently doesn't compile unless fno-exceptions
      is added because:
      - it tries to generate sjlj exception handling code, and
      - it tries to generate exception tables using label-addressed .byte sequence.
        Ptx doesn't support generating random data at a label, nor being able to
        load/write data relative to a label.
      
      This patch fixes the first problem by using UI_TARGET for nvptx.
      
      The second problem is worked around by generating all .byte sequences commented
      out.  It would be better to have a narrower workaround, and define
      TARGET_ASM_BYTE_OP to "error: .byte unsupported " or some such.
      
      This patch does not enable exceptions for nvptx, it merely allows c++ programs
      to run correctly if they do no use exception handling.
      
      Build and reg-tested on x86_64 with nvptx accelerator.

    • [libgomp, openacc, testsuite] Fix async logic in lib-12.f90 · 6dd58010
      In testcase lib-12.f90, all acc_async_test calls are placed in a location
      where they are not guaranteed to succeed, which explains why there's an xfail
      for the lower optimization levels.
      
      This patch fixes the problem by moving the acc_async_test calls to the correct
      locations.
      
      Reg-tested on x86_64 with nvptx accelerator.

    • [libgomp, openacc, testsuite] Fix async/wait logic in lib-13.f90 · b2eb1779
      The purpose of the lib-13.f90 test-case is to test acc_wait_all_async.  The
      test indeed calls acc_wait_all_async, but then subsequentlys calls
      acc_wait_all, so the acc_wait_all_async functionality is not tested.
      Furthermore, all acc_async_test calls are placed in a location where they are
      not guaranteed to succeed, which explains why there's an xfail for the lower
      optimization levels.
      
      This patch fixes the problems by replacing acc_wait_all with an acc_wait on
      the async id used for the acc_wait_all_async call, and moving the
      acc_async_test calls to the correct locations.
      
      Reg-tested on x86_64 with nvptx accelerator.
